HOA Won't Return calls

Have contacted the HOA 5 times in the last 4 months with NO return call. 

Looking for a copy of our HOA agreement since retired persons aren't supposed to pay yearly fee (I was on the original HOA and this was grandfathered) yet HOA places liens on property.

The Recorder of Deeds in Clay County, Mo, has the Bylaws. Book 2027, Page 764, Dated April 15, 1991, page 4 of 6, Section 6 stating "If all homeowners of a residence are sixty-two (62) years of age or older and retired, then they are exempt from Paying annual Association assessment for only the residence in which they live." 

Had to get an Attorney since we are more than a decade over 62, are retired and still being harassed by HOA to pay dues. 

If a detailed message of name, phone number, and reason for the call is left on the HOA phone, a return call will be made.  If no one answers that return call, a mesage to call back is required, otherwise it is assumed the problem is solved. Another method of communciation is to email the secretary at halhhomes@aol.com.  For the exemption, a valid drivers license of age and proof of all owners being retired without outside employement must be presented to the secretary. 

All the official documents of the HOA are located on this website in the Pages & Links section.

The exemption goes into affect after you submit proof of age & retirement for the dues after that date.  It does not erase the previous dues owed before that time of proof presented.  Many people over the age of 62 and retired may still pay the dues to support the neighborhood or may have other employment after their retirement from one job.
